COVID-19 cases climb 

The Ministry of Health confirmed three additional cases of COVID-19 on New Providence yesterday.

The patients are a 26-year-old woman, a 36-year-old man and a 54-year-old woman, according to the ministry.

All three individuals are isolated in their homes.

The ministry said eight COVID-19 patients still remain hospitalized in serious or critical condition.

There are 92 cases of the virus in The Bahamas; 55 of those cases are active.

So far, 11 people, who were positive for the virus, have died.

The ministry said 1,500 people have been tested for COVID-19 so far.
